Magna Concursos

Foram encontradas 368 questões.

413886 Ano: 2017
Disciplina: TI - Banco de Dados
Banca: FCC
Orgão: TRE-PR
Provas:

Atenção: Para responder à questão, considere as informações abaixo.

Considere a existência de um banco de dados com as tabelas criadas pelos comandos abaixo.

enunciado 413886-1

Ao tentar alterar na tabela Partido o idPartido de PNC para PNCT, foi exibida a mensagem "Cannot delete or update a parent row: a foreign key constraint fails". Isso ocorreu porque o Sistema Gerenciador de Banco de Dados não conseguiu alterar na tabela Filiado o idPartido dos filiados ao PNC para PNCT. Para que a alteração fosse bem sucedida, no momento da criação da tabela Filiado, à cláusula REFERENCES deveria ter sido adicionada a cláusula
 

Provas

Questão presente nas seguintes provas
413885 Ano: 2017
Disciplina: TI - Banco de Dados
Banca: FCC
Orgão: TRE-PR

Considere a tabela ItemPedido abaixo, onde a chave primária é composta pelos campos NumeroPedido e NumeroItemPedido.

enunciado 413885-1

É correto afirmar que

 

Provas

Questão presente nas seguintes provas
413884 Ano: 2017
Disciplina: TI - Ciência de Dados e BI
Banca: FCC
Orgão: TRE-PR
A Data Warehouse supports Online Analytical Process − OLAP providing a flexible and analytical manner of storing data. In a Data Warehouse, data are stored in
 

Provas

Questão presente nas seguintes provas
413883 Ano: 2017
Disciplina: TI - Banco de Dados
Banca: FCC
Orgão: TRE-PR

O gerenciamento de transações em um banco de dados deve considerar um conjunto de propriedades conhecidas pela sigla ACID.

I. Uma transação interrompida ao meio pode deixar o banco de dados em um estado inconsistente. O banco de dados deve prover recursos para remoção dos efeitos de transações incompletas, garantindo assim a autenticidade.

II. A consistência tem por objetivo garantir que o banco de dados antes da transação esteja consistente e que após a transação permaneça consistente. Todas as regras devem ser aplicadas às modificações da transação para manter toda a integridade dos dados.

III. Modificações feitas por transações simultâneas devem ser isoladas das modificações feitas por qualquer outra transação simultânea. O isolamento deve garantir que duas transações, executadas de forma concorrente, devem ter o mesmo resultado que teria se fossem executadas em ordem serial.

IV. O SGBD mantém um registro (log) das ações executadas pelo usuário para que, se ocorrer queda do sistema antes que todas as mudanças tenham sido feitas em disco, este log seja usado para restaurar o estado do banco de dados quando o sistema for reiniciado, garantindo assim a disponibilidade.

As propriedades ACID sublinhadas que estão corretamente definidas são as que constam APENAS em

 

Provas

Questão presente nas seguintes provas
413882 Ano: 2017
Disciplina: TI - Banco de Dados
Banca: FCC
Orgão: TRE-PR
Um Database Administrator − DBA Oracle deseja conceder à usuária Maria os privilégios para criar sessão de conexão no banco de dados e criar tabelas, permitindo ainda que ela possa estender seus privilégios para outros usuários. O comando que o DBA deverá utilizar é:
 

Provas

Questão presente nas seguintes provas
413881 Ano: 2017
Disciplina: TI - Banco de Dados
Banca: FCC
Orgão: TRE-PR

Considere a existência de um procedure escrito em PL/SQL denominado verifica_votacao, que aceita dois parâmetros: um para a string do ID do candidato e outro para o número de votos obtidos em uma eleição.

CREATE OR REPLACE PROCEDURE verifica_votacao(id_do_cand NUMBER, num_vot_cand NUMBER) IS /* implementação do restante do procedure */

Um DBA Oracle criou um trigger verifica_votacao_trg na tabela candidatos que é acionado antes de uma operação INSERT ou UPDATE. Em cada linha o trigger deve chamar o procedure verifica_votacao para executar a lógica de negócios e deve especificar o novo ID de candidato e o novo número de votos para os parâmetros do procedure.

CREATE OR REPLACE TRIGGER verifica_votacao_trg

...I ... INSERT OR UPDATE OF id_cand, num_vot

ON candidatos

FOR EACH ROW

BEGIN

verifica_votacao(..II ..);

END;

/

SHOW ERRORS

As lacunas I e II devem ser preenchidas, correta e respectivamente, por

 

Provas

Questão presente nas seguintes provas
413880 Ano: 2017
Disciplina: TI - Banco de Dados
Banca: FCC
Orgão: TRE-PR

Em um banco de dados aberto e em condições ideais, uma tabela chamada processo possui os registros abaixo.

NumeroProcesso DataAbertura

1279678-05.2016.1.00.0001 2016-12-26

4598765-03.2017.1.90.0002 2017-01-15

6789764-02.2016.1.80.0003 2016-03-30

9876534-05.2016.1.00.0000 2016-03-20

Ao ser digitado um comando SQL, foi exibido na tela.

NumeroProcesso DataAbertura

6789764-02.2016.1.80.0003 2016-03-30

9876534-05.2016.1.00.0000 2016-03-20

O comando digitado foi:

 

Provas

Questão presente nas seguintes provas
413879 Ano: 2017
Disciplina: TI - Banco de Dados
Banca: FCC
Orgão: TRE-PR
Um Database Administrator − DBA criou uma função no Oracle chamada programador utilizando o comando CREATE ROLE programador;. Em seguida, concedeu o privilégio de criação de tabela à função utilizando o comando GRANT create table TO programador;. Para conceder a função programador ao usuário Pedro, o DBA deve utilizar o comando
 

Provas

Questão presente nas seguintes provas
413878 Ano: 2017
Disciplina: TI - Banco de Dados
Banca: FCC
Orgão: TRE-PR
Em um banco de dados aberto e em condições ideais, uma tabela processo possui um campo NumeroProcesso do tipo varchar2. Para selecionar somente os registros cujo campo NumeroProcesso possua como segundo caractere (da esquerda para a direita), o valor 2, utiliza-se a instrução SELECT * FROM processo WHERE NumeroProcesso
 

Provas

Questão presente nas seguintes provas
413877 Ano: 2017
Disciplina: TI - Banco de Dados
Banca: FCC
Orgão: TRE-PR

Um Programador deseja realizar uma consulta na tabela Advogado, para obter o conteúdo de cada palavra do campo NomeAdvogado com as letras iniciais maiúsculas, já que alguns nomes foram cadastrados em letras minúsculas. Para isso, utilizou o comando abaixo.

SELECT ..I.. (NomeAdvogado) FROM Advogado;

A lacuna I deve ser preenchida corretamente com

 

Provas

Questão presente nas seguintes provas